Add notify after visible state change for eail_widget
authorMichal Jagiello <m.jagiello@samsung.com>
Wed, 11 Dec 2013 10:10:43 +0000 (11:10 +0100)
committerMichal Jagiello <m.jagiello@samsung.com>
Wed, 11 Dec 2013 10:10:43 +0000 (11:10 +0100)
eail/eail/eail_widget.c

index 6c20e85..6b715d8 100644 (file)
@@ -1,4 +1,4 @@
-/*
+ /*
  * Copyright (c) 2013 Samsung Electronics Co., Ltd.
  *
  * This library is free software; you can redistribute it and/or
@@ -102,6 +102,7 @@ eail_widget_on_show(void *data, Evas *e, Evas_Object *obj, void *event_info)
    g_return_if_fail(ATK_IS_OBJECT(data));
 
    atk_object_notify_state_change(ATK_OBJECT(data), ATK_STATE_SHOWING, TRUE);
+   atk_object_notify_state_change(ATK_OBJECT(data), ATK_STATE_VISIBLE, TRUE);
 }
 
 /**
@@ -118,6 +119,7 @@ eail_widget_on_hide(void *data, Evas *e, Evas_Object *obj, void *event_info)
    g_return_if_fail(ATK_IS_OBJECT(data));
 
    atk_object_notify_state_change(ATK_OBJECT(data), ATK_STATE_SHOWING, FALSE);
+   atk_object_notify_state_change(ATK_OBJECT(data), ATK_STATE_VISIBLE, FALSE);
 }
 
 /**